如何通过区块链技术确保数据安全?深度解析与应用示例
随着数字化的不断发展,数据安全问题愈发引起广泛关注。在这个信息透明化的时代,用户对个人信息及敏感数据的保护需求不断增加,而区块链技术因其独特的优势而成为解决这一问题的重要工具。本文将深入探讨区块链如何保障数据安全,并分享相关的应用示例,帮助读者更好地理解这一技术在数据安全领域的潜力。
一、区块链技术的基本概念
在讨论如何保障数据安全之前,首先需要了解区块链技术的基本概念。区块链是一种分布式账本技术,它通过加密算法将数据块(区块)链接成链(区块链),每个区块中包含了一部分数据及其前一个区块的哈希值。这种设计使得一旦数据被写入区块之后,就无法被篡改或删除,从而保证了数据的可靠性与安全性。
二、区块链保障数据安全的核心机制
区块链能够保障数据安全的主要原因在于以下几个核心机制:
- 去中心化:传统的数据存储方式集中在单一或少量服务器上,一旦服务器遭遇攻击,数据就可能被丢失或被篡改。而区块链技术通过去中心化的形式,将数据分散存储在网络中多个节点上,使得即使某个节点受损,其他节点仍然能够保证数据的完整性。
- 加密算法:区块链使用强大的加密技术保护数据安全。数据在被添加到区块之前,会通过加密算法进行处理,确保只有持有特定密钥的用户才能访问和解密数据。
- 共识机制:区块链使用共识机制来保证数据的一致性。所有节点在添加新数据之前,必须经过一致的验证过程,这意味着数据在进入区块链之前会经过全网节点的确认,从而防止了数据的不正当更改。
- 不可篡改性:每个区块都包含了前一个区块的哈希值,这确保了区块链的任何部分都无法独立更改。如果有人试图篡改某个区块,后续的所有区块都将受到影响,这种机制有效地阻止了篡改行为。
三、区块链在数据安全方面的应用案例
随着对区块链技术认识的深入,其在各个行业中的应用逐步开展。以下是一些典型的应用案例:
1. 供应链管理
在供应链管理中,企业需要追踪商品从生产到销售的每一个环节。通过使用区块链,企业可以实时记录每次转运的信息,所有相关方都可以访问这一信息,确保数据的真实性与透明性,防止假货的问题。
2. 医疗数据安全
医疗行业涉及大量敏感数据,包括病人的历史记录和治疗方案。区块链能够在确保患者隐私的基础上,提供一个安全的方式分享和更新医疗数据,各个医疗机构可以通过区块链来确认患者记录的真实性,同时防止数据被非法篡改。
3. 数字身份认证
在数字化时代,身份安全变得愈加重要。借助区块链技术,可以为每一个个体提供一个唯一且不可伪造的身份认证,用户可以自己掌控个人数据的使用权限,确保身份信息的安全性。
四、区块链安全性的局限与挑战
虽然区块链技术在数据安全方面有诸多优势,但也并非完美,仍然存在一些局限性和挑战:
- 技术复杂性:区块链技术相对较新,许多企业和个人仍缺乏掌握这一技术的能力。此外,实现区块链系统的开发和维护也需要专业知识,增加了实施成本。
- 网络安全问题:虽然区块链本身具有高安全性,但其网络环境仍可能遭受攻击。例如,51%攻击(控制超过半数节点)可能导致数据被篡改,虽然这种情况在大型区块链中不易实现,但在小型网络中仍需警惕。
- 法律和法规问题:区块链的去中心化特性使得管理与监管变得复杂,现行法规有时无法适应区块链的运行特点,这也限制了其在敏感行业(如金融和医疗)的广泛应用。
五、未来展望:区块链与数据安全的结合
尽管面临挑战,区块链技术在数据安全领域的潜力依然巨大。随着技术的不断成熟,更多的企业和机构将认识到区块链的重要性。未来,随着新的安全技术的结合,如人工智能和云计算,相信会找到更为高效和安全的数据解决方案。
总而言之,区块链技术的确为数据安全提供了新的可能性。其去中心化、不可篡改、透明可追溯的特性,使得区块链在保护用户数据、构建信任关系、改善数据管理上均展现出强大优势。
感谢您耐心阅读本篇文章,希望通过此次分享,您能收获关于区块链技术与数据安全的深入理解,对后续从事相关工作的我们身心愉悦,看成效能更大形成帮助。